Hi everyone. I was adjusting my computer's RAM and it seemed to clash with my system, causing freezes and odd visual problems. After switching back, I noticed some icons in the Start menu now appear as a white box with a cross when searched. If I browse apps without searching, they look normal, but when searched, they look random. I tried running SFC and DISM commands, but they didn’t fix anything.

Based on your words, the Windows Search Index was damaged. I recommend removing it and rebuilding it from scratch. This will also refresh the thumbnail indexing. Here’s a guide from MajorGeeks: How to Delete and Rebuild the Windows 10 & 11 Search Index.
